Navigating the Features Landscape: What to Look for in a Robot Hoover

Picking the ideal robot hoover includes thinking about a number of key features to guarantee it fulfills your specific requirements and home environment. Here's a breakdown of vital aspects to assess:

Navigation System: This is the "brain" of the robot hoover.
Random Bounce Navigation: Basic designs utilize this system, bouncing arbitrarily around the room until they cover the area. They are less efficient and might miss out on spots.Methodical Navigation (Line-by-Line or Room-by-Room): More advanced models use sensing units and mapping technology (like gyroscopes, electronic cameras, or LiDAR) to clean in a structured pattern. This is far more effective and makes sure extensive protection.Mapping and Room Recognition: Premium models develop a map of your home, enabling zoned cleaning, virtual limits, and room-specific cleaning schedules. This is perfect for bigger homes or those with particular cleaning requirements for different rooms.
Suction Power and Cleaning Performance: Suction power identifies how effectively the robot hoover chooses up dirt and debris.
Think about floor types: Homes with carpets need greater suction power than those with mainly difficult floors.Pet Hair Specific Models: Look for designs specifically created for pet hair, frequently including more powerful suction and specialized brush rolls.
Battery Life and Charging: Battery life determines the duration of a cleaning cycle.
Consider your home size: Larger homes require longer battery life.auto vacuum cleaner-Recharge and Resume: Many models immediately return to their charging dock when the battery is low and can resume cleaning where they ended. This is an essential function for bigger homes or longer cleaning cycles.
Dustbin Capacity and Emptying: The dustbin size determines how often you require to empty it.
Bigger dustbins need less frequent emptying.Self-Emptying Docks: Some high-end designs feature self-emptying docks that instantly empty the robot's dustbin into a bigger container, further minimizing upkeep frequency.
Brush System: The brush system is crucial for reliable debris elimination.
Main Brush Roll: Look for a mix brush roll (bristles and rubber fins) for efficient cleaning on both carpets and hard floorings.Side Brushes: Side brushes assist sweep particles from edges and corners into the path of the primary brush.
Purification System: The filtration system captures dust and irritants.
HEPA Filters: Essential for allergic reaction patients, HEPA filters trap fine dust particles and irritants, enhancing air quality.
Smart Features and App Control: Modern robot hoovers typically include smart features and app control.
Scheduling: Set cleaning schedules for specific times and days.Zone Cleaning: Define particular locations to clean or prevent.Virtual Boundaries: Create invisible walls to avoid the robot from getting in specific areas.Voice Control Integration: Some models incorporate with voice assistants like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ant.
Barrier Avoidance and Cliff Sensors:
Obstacle Avoidance: Advanced sensing units help robotics browse around furniture and barriers efficiently, lessening bumping and getting stuck.Cliff Sensors: Prevent the robot from falling down stairs or edges.
Noise Level: Robot hoovers differ in sound level. Think about models with quieter operation if sound level of sensitivity is an issue.

Maintaining Your Autonomous Assistant: Care and Longevity

To ensure your robot hoover continues to carry out optimally and lasts for years to come, regular maintenance is necessary.

Here are vital upkeep tasks:
Empty the Dustbin Regularly: Empty the dustbin after each cleaning cycle or as required. A full dustbin decreases suction power and cleaning efficiency.Clean the Brushes: Regularly eliminate and clean hair and particles tangled around the main brush and side brushes. This avoids blockage and makes sure effective debris pickup.Clean the Filters: Clean or change the filters according to the producer's recommendations. Clean filters keep good suction and air quality.Wipe Down Sensors: Periodically wipe down the sensing units (cliff sensors, wall sensing units, and so on) with a soft, dry cloth to ensure they work properly for navigation and challenge avoidance.Inspect and Clean Wheels: Ensure the wheels are devoid of particles and can turn efficiently for ideal navigation.Change Parts as Needed: Brush rolls, filters, and in some cases batteries will require replacement gradually. Follow the maker's recommendations for replacement periods to maintain peak performance.
